Output 01a1a8c5d26e7164d4772fa40caa749a8c7746ff14dfd3e028c6846df7098bb9:23

value
680864557
script pubkey
OP_0 OP_PUSHBYTES_20 2f53a1c8e482f374ee8aae19ac8a4e76f7b12d5d
address
bc1q9af6rj8ystehfm524cv6ezjwwmmmzt2aehs3fd
transaction
01a1a8c5d26e7164d4772fa40caa749a8c7746ff14dfd3e028c6846df7098bb9
confirmations
285626
spent
true